Where abortion will be banned, restricted and protected without Roe v. Wade

Source: Guttmacher Institute
“Banned” states have so-called trigger laws intended to take effect now that Roe is overturned. “Restricted” states have passed laws since 1973 that are no longer unconstitutional without Roe. “Could be restricted” states have laws from before 1973 that could go into effect. “Protected” states currently have laws that protect the right to abortion. Data as of June 1, 2022.
